Recently, in an interview, the JAMB boss has said that candidates were on their own if they can’t use a computer system. These were his exact words below… ‘ The national curriculum on computer education is there, if they are not exposed to it, that is their problem. But I’m saying that is not even the matter. I’m saying if you can use your handset, you can do computer based test. All it says is: here are the questions. What is your response? Then you click or you touch it, either you use the mouse or you press the button A, B,C or D for the answer and then the next question comes up.’ he said this after been asked a question on why JAMB didn’t wait till students have computer based curricula before introducing the compulsory CBT test. http://acadablog.com/if-candidates-cant-use-computers-its-their-problem-dibu-ojerinde-jamb-boss/ 1 Share

The management of the university of ilorin has denied sending some girls back during the just concluded post utme examination for indecent dressing. The deputy vice chancellor Prof.(mrs) N.Y.S. Ijaiya stated that candidates were already aware of the school's dress code and regulations through its website and had no reason to be sent back. She also said that those who dressed indecently through wearing of short skirts were only counselled and emphasized that they were never sent back. Recall that the school was reported to have sent back about four post utme candidates due to indecent dressing. |
